I can't load avast! after installation
« on: April 05, 2006, 12:57:49 PM »
I uninstalled my previous antivirus software and installed avast! home edition. After reboot my pc my avast! icon on the desktop is not what it supposed to be. When i double click on the icon. The pc shows unable to locate "ashAvast.exe".
I can't locate this application either.
What should i do?

The pc shows unable to locate "ashAvast.exe".
Your installation is obviously corrupted...
You need to uninstall, boot, install again and boot.
That files should be here: C:\Program Files\Alwil Software\Avast4\

PS : I had Norton before Avast but I have desinstalled Norton perfectly ( i found the method in Internet ) ...
Well... you need really get rid of Norton.
1) Remove NAV through Add/Remove programs from Control Panel. Boot.
2) Use Symantec removal tool (browse their site to get it, there are one for each antivirus series). Removing your Norton program using SymNRT.
3) Boot.
4) Install avast! Boot.
5) See what you get.

It was exactly what I did but It doesn't work normally ... :-\

Can you please add the following lines to setup.ini (in avast4\setup):

[BufferLog]
Enable=1

Then start update/repair again, and SetupDbg.log should be generated.
Please, post the contents here, it should give us a clue of the problem.

Other option is posting the last lines of the setup.log (at that same folder).
